Description
This ASIC provides up to 350mA of drive current for driving a relay. On-chip diagnostic features include open and short circuit detection in the on state, duty cycle current limit control, and thermal shutdown. Faults are reported on the
lead. is an active-low output. An on-chip zener provides protec­tion from flyback pulses from the relay. Internal pull-down circuitry is provided to ensure the output pin turns off when the Control pin is floating.

Circuit Description
The CS1107 relay driver IC provides up to 350mA of drive current in a low-side configuration. The Output driver pin is controlled through the TTL compatible Control input pin. A high condition on the Control pin turns the output pin on.
The pin reports short circuit, open circuit, and overtemperature conditions on the IC. If a fault is present, the open collector output pin will be low. Typical numbers for faults are: exceeding 500mA of drive current will report a short circuit. Less than 40mA (typical) will report an open circuit. A temperature fault will be reported when the die temperature exceeds 180¡C (typical). Faults
are only reported when the Control pin is high, due to the low quiescent current when the Control pin is low and the output device is turned off.
Overcurrent protection is provided by duty cycle control. When the Output current exceeds the current limit thresh­old, the output enters duty cycle mode to reduce power dissipation of the IC to a safe level. The higher the thresh­old is exceeded the lower the duty cycle becomes.
A 33V on-chip zener diode on the Output pin protects the device from flyback pulses when a relay is turned off. The saturation voltage of this pin will not exceed 1.5V at 350mA.
